{ "info": { "author": "Ingeniweb", "author_email": "support@ingeniweb.com", "bugtrack_url": null, "classifiers": [ "Programming Language :: Python", "Topic :: Software Development :: Libraries :: Python Modules" ], "description": "=========================\niw.recipe.fetcher package\n=========================\n\n.. contents::\n\nWhat is iw.recipe.fetcher ?\n===========================\n\nDownload an url to a local directory.\n\nHow to use iw.recipe.fetcher ?\n==============================\n\nThe recipe download from an http server::\n\n >>> server_data = tmpdir('server_data')\n >>> write(server_data, 'file1.txt', 'test1')\n >>> write(server_data, 'file2.txt', 'test1')\n >>> write(server_data, 'file3.txt', 'test1')\n\n >>> server_url = start_server(server_data)\n\nWe need some buildout vars::\n\n >>> write('buildout.cfg', '''\n ... [buildout]\n ... parts=test1\n ...\n ... [test1]\n ... recipe=iw.recipe.fetcher\n ... urls=\n ... %(server_url)s/file1.txt\n ... base_url=%(server_url)s\n ... files=\n ... file2.txt\n ... file3.txt\n ... ''' % dict(server_url=server_url))\n\n\nNow we can fetch some urls::\n \n >>> print system(buildout)\n Installing test1.\n \n\n\n\nIt works::\n\n >>> ls(sample_buildout, 'test1')\n - file1.txt\n - file2.txt\n - file3.txt\n\n\n >>> write('buildout.cfg', '''\n ... [buildout]\n ... parts=test2\n ...\n ... [test2]\n ... recipe=iw.recipe.fetcher\n ... urls=\n ... http://www.example.com/file1.txt\n ... find-links=%(server_url)s\n ... ''' % dict(server_url=server_url))\n\n\nNow we can fetch some urls::\n \n >>> print system(buildout)\n Uninstalling test1.\n Installing test2.\n ", "description_content_type": null, "docs_url": null, "download_url": "UNKNOWN", "downloads": { "last_day": -1, "last_month": -1, "last_week": -1 }, "home_page": "UNKNOWN", "keywords": "", "license": "GPL", "maintainer": null, "maintainer_email": null, "name": "iw.recipe.fetcher", "package_url": "https://pypi.org/project/iw.recipe.fetcher/", "platform": "UNKNOWN", "project_url": "https://pypi.org/project/iw.recipe.fetcher/", "project_urls": { "Download": "UNKNOWN", "Homepage": "UNKNOWN" }, "release_url": "https://pypi.org/project/iw.recipe.fetcher/0.2/", "requires_dist": null, "requires_python": null, "summary": "ZC buildout recipe to fetch urls", "version": "0.2" }, "last_serial": 755362, "releases": { "0.1": [ { "comment_text": "", "digests": { "md5": "d9ee0ede56c7c1181409a9f29716888f", "sha256": "797478a96457f056f02cd36d402a9bd9a2adadc4316257d48535877bfe59b036" }, "downloads": -1, "filename": "iw.recipe.fetcher-0.1-py2.4.egg", "has_sig": false, "md5_digest": "d9ee0ede56c7c1181409a9f29716888f", "packagetype": "bdist_egg", "python_version": "2.4", "requires_python": null, "size": 9712, "upload_time": "2007-12-05T10:25:23", "url": "https://files.pythonhosted.org/packages/42/c8/78c88e11a7f49d0a2db184ab63ec89bdbf66fed6319f65b53366405f7b08/iw.recipe.fetcher-0.1-py2.4.egg" } ], "0.1dev-r6543": [ { "comment_text": "", "digests": { "md5": "31e30f1083054ca351141ce16a20837e", "sha256": "29c4fe09cb4fedefc0356f144f27d358145dc20bfb325b37c25858dbe088f53c" }, "downloads": -1, "filename": "iw.recipe.fetcher-0.1dev_r6543-py2.4.egg", "has_sig": false, "md5_digest": "31e30f1083054ca351141ce16a20837e", "packagetype": "bdist_egg", "python_version": "2.4", "requires_python": null, "size": 9420, "upload_time": "2007-11-05T17:31:56", "url": "https://files.pythonhosted.org/packages/c2/75/4cf0f19fe5f52b9a713946f28936d5566c901ecf968b01c8a72ec9a2cec3/iw.recipe.fetcher-0.1dev_r6543-py2.4.egg" } ], "0.1dev-r6544": [ { "comment_text": "", "digests": { "md5": "7d7a9723bd3e65b1ec3f1b9e718ddc7b", "sha256": "e1a8de357c60b77ab996af1349ba7b9bf542131be177658d70d7cbdbc44c3010" }, "downloads": -1, "filename": "iw.recipe.fetcher-0.1dev_r6544-py2.4.egg", "has_sig": false, "md5_digest": "7d7a9723bd3e65b1ec3f1b9e718ddc7b", "packagetype": "bdist_egg", "python_version": "2.4", "requires_python": null, "size": 9608, "upload_time": "2007-11-05T17:47:57", "url": "https://files.pythonhosted.org/packages/6f/f1/6acf7ac1395eb31a348fd0b6484df447285958506f388e3b07ebdcf9dcad/iw.recipe.fetcher-0.1dev_r6544-py2.4.egg" } ], "0.1dev-r6545": [ { "comment_text": "", "digests": { "md5": "5359169f17d94df1f07abf4ffff362af", "sha256": "42a13a30b2b7777277bd7065d30286ea313d75e7370b823cbcf02c4207ad0ace" }, "downloads": -1, "filename": "iw.recipe.fetcher-0.1dev_r6545-py2.4.egg", "has_sig": false, "md5_digest": "5359169f17d94df1f07abf4ffff362af", "packagetype": "bdist_egg", "python_version": "2.4", "requires_python": null, "size": 9617, "upload_time": "2007-11-05T17:51:41", "url": "https://files.pythonhosted.org/packages/02/a5/f38e2721ce6e50bf713bc3e52cde722945606c2ed1a015580672434c709d/iw.recipe.fetcher-0.1dev_r6545-py2.4.egg" } ], "0.1dev-r6546": [ { "comment_text": "", "digests": { "md5": "787d7e105ecd8050faec9d6543ae2a3a", "sha256": "2cfc83299ddeeadbc9a55692fd07d1245f2a6f7cd02915c34440aa0012459d0b" }, "downloads": -1, "filename": "iw.recipe.fetcher-0.1dev_r6546-py2.4.egg", "has_sig": false, "md5_digest": "787d7e105ecd8050faec9d6543ae2a3a", "packagetype": "bdist_egg", "python_version": "2.4", "requires_python": null, "size": 9687, "upload_time": "2007-11-05T18:04:37", "url": "https://files.pythonhosted.org/packages/89/d3/e7878c4b776a7e55c884a974aeb3c48353250855892453da97d83c150587/iw.recipe.fetcher-0.1dev_r6546-py2.4.egg" } ], "0.1dev-r6547": [ { "comment_text": "", "digests": { "md5": "760c1898a4ad4993351729073e820022", "sha256": "89b7b470ca33ae3de9dc2869ce6d183786fabbe6d09f1d052c0b30386a25fbbd" }, "downloads": -1, "filename": "iw.recipe.fetcher-0.1dev_r6547-py2.4.egg", "has_sig": false, "md5_digest": "760c1898a4ad4993351729073e820022", "packagetype": "bdist_egg", "python_version": "2.4", "requires_python": null, "size": 9684, "upload_time": "2007-11-05T18:10:29", "url": "https://files.pythonhosted.org/packages/58/2a/d777a23f0c31655ad814ba6890fcf1689da0c52808a2a74538c9566e83bf/iw.recipe.fetcher-0.1dev_r6547-py2.4.egg" } ], "0.1dev-r6548": [ { "comment_text": "", "digests": { "md5": "0a0a6843df6a9bd43f4ee2e7f2566fd9", "sha256": "c25aebe7e0fd5c48de483e91f83b4c8f6f10b63b359e5743538e4454df193cad" }, "downloads": -1, "filename": "iw.recipe.fetcher-0.1dev_r6548-py2.4.egg", "has_sig": false, "md5_digest": "0a0a6843df6a9bd43f4ee2e7f2566fd9", "packagetype": "bdist_egg", "python_version": "2.4", "requires_python": null, "size": 9730, "upload_time": "2007-11-05T18:18:20", "url": "https://files.pythonhosted.org/packages/41/53/73fd4e411ef1031dcd07586bd086094152bad13925623e16ef0a3bb1f8e7/iw.recipe.fetcher-0.1dev_r6548-py2.4.egg" } ], "0.1dev-r6556": [ { "comment_text": "", "digests": { "md5": "75350c131734fc5b3fe3927a16505906", "sha256": "f2cab68f621ffcf08e3741874fbc762a72ce7c848a3e4cbf6fdcf7b346c85c79" }, "downloads": -1, "filename": "iw.recipe.fetcher-0.1dev_r6556-py2.4.egg", "has_sig": false, "md5_digest": "75350c131734fc5b3fe3927a16505906", "packagetype": "bdist_egg", "python_version": "2.4", "requires_python": null, "size": 9715, "upload_time": "2007-11-07T11:06:56", "url": "https://files.pythonhosted.org/packages/1e/a7/50dd0f75e25cbf603dfd3288656a293c734c65c3c8e6b19adb685e458fb4/iw.recipe.fetcher-0.1dev_r6556-py2.4.egg" } ], "0.2": [ { "comment_text": "", "digests": { "md5": "710b35be21b2fb1cdd2d5897194e6fd5", "sha256": "05de36a647efb5571fad8a1d970e84e0c835abbe58d3575ac70ca205d9ee6268" }, "downloads": -1, "filename": "iw.recipe.fetcher-0.2-py2.4.egg", "has_sig": false, "md5_digest": "710b35be21b2fb1cdd2d5897194e6fd5", "packagetype": "bdist_egg", "python_version": "2.4", "requires_python": null, "size": 10361, "upload_time": "2008-01-11T09:45:46", "url": "https://files.pythonhosted.org/packages/fc/6e/3b2e8856512d73b241824c0a96259df7b88e886d12a705b39d46e418f290/iw.recipe.fetcher-0.2-py2.4.egg" }, { "comment_text": "", "digests": { "md5": "c200b73c998e54a963bd0cd7248ab298", "sha256": "52487dfe3a9538712cf051c89c4c6bb8402a6685d2fbdf2efcac96cf2c2a6c7f" }, "downloads": -1, "filename": "iw.recipe.fetcher-0.2.tar.gz", "has_sig": false, "md5_digest": "c200b73c998e54a963bd0cd7248ab298",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 4307, "upload_time": "2008-01-11T09:45:44", "url": "https://files.pythonhosted.org/packages/e5/5a/56fc2a12f01cc4bcbacbe99f3c62215d73ca22e0f47c697e84debcc5ee18/iw.recipe.fetcher-0.2.tar.gz" } ] }, "urls": [ { "comment_text": "", "digests": { "md5": "710b35be21b2fb1cdd2d5897194e6fd5", "sha256": "05de36a647efb5571fad8a1d970e84e0c835abbe58d3575ac70ca205d9ee6268" }, "downloads": -1, "filename": "iw.recipe.fetcher-0.2-py2.4.egg", "has_sig": false, "md5_digest": "710b35be21b2fb1cdd2d5897194e6fd5", "packagetype": "bdist_egg", "python_version": "2.4", "requires_python": null, "size": 10361, "upload_time": "2008-01-11T09:45:46", "url": "https://files.pythonhosted.org/packages/fc/6e/3b2e8856512d73b241824c0a96259df7b88e886d12a705b39d46e418f290/iw.recipe.fetcher-0.2-py2.4.egg" }, { "comment_text": "", "digests": { "md5": "c200b73c998e54a963bd0cd7248ab298", "sha256": "52487dfe3a9538712cf051c89c4c6bb8402a6685d2fbdf2efcac96cf2c2a6c7f" }, "downloads": -1, "filename": "iw.recipe.fetcher-0.2.tar.gz", "has_sig": false, "md5_digest": "c200b73c998e54a963bd0cd7248ab298",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 4307, "upload_time": "2008-01-11T09:45:44", "url": "https://files.pythonhosted.org/packages/e5/5a/56fc2a12f01cc4bcbacbe99f3c62215d73ca22e0f47c697e84debcc5ee18/iw.recipe.fetcher-0.2.tar.gz" } ] }